Output d6c8dae05a76b1660d2775fefe2fd3f47578a962025e8cab830cc3bbfd3f2b29:7

value
781562
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85a3a0b10305e480bf5cd04267cd23418b1c6615 OP_EQUAL
address
3Dsdp7HXQ36qyePqs4ejiiFxi4es2G2JS3
transaction
d6c8dae05a76b1660d2775fefe2fd3f47578a962025e8cab830cc3bbfd3f2b29
spent
true